How can I count items in a JavaScript array but only when items are the same next to each other?


I have an array for example like this:

{John, John, John, Maria, Peter, Peter, Maria, Anna, Anna, Maria, Maria, Peter}

I need to get result like:

1 -> 3
2 -> 1
3 -> 2
4 -> 1
5 -> 2
6 -> 2
7 -> 1


Solution

  • I group the names, then I count them.

    const array = ['John', 'John', 'John', 'Maria', 'Peter', 'Peter', 'Maria', 'Anna', 'Anna', 'Maria', 'Maria', 'Peter'];
    
    let final = [];
    const count = array.forEach(item => {
                       //check whether the last item in the array has the same name
                       if ( final[final.length - 1] && final[final.length-1][0] === item ) {
                            final[final.length -1].push(item)
                       } else {
                            //if different name then create a new grouping
                            final[final.length] = [item]
                       }
    })
    console.log(final.map(item => item.length)) //returns the size of each group
    console.log('final array', final)
